Samba3 + OpenLdap classicupgrade problems - Administrator sambaSID != *-500

Kamen Mazdrashki kamenim at samba.org
Thu Apr 10 20:02:43 MDT 2014


Hi,

I am playing with 'samba-tool domain classicupgrade' and I can't import
existing users - more specifically, the Administrator.

I have Samba3 + OpenLdap passdb backend.
Trying 'samba-tool domain classicupgrade ...' always lead me to:
Importing users
User 'Administrator' in your existing directory has SID
S-1-5-21-2051375009-2767682937-3133487178-2024, expected it to be
S-1-5-21-2051375009-2767682937-3133487178-500
ERROR(<class 'samba.provision.ProvisioningError'>): uncaught exception -
ProvisioningError: User 'Administrator' in your existing directory does not
have SID ending in -500
  File
"/opt/samba4/lib64/python2.7/site-packages/samba/netcmd/__init__.py", line
175, in _run
    return self.run(*args, **kwargs)
  File "/opt/samba4/lib64/python2.7/site-packages/samba/netcmd/domain.py",
line 1318, in run
    useeadb=eadb, dns_backend=dns_backend, use_ntvfs=use_ntvfs)
  File "/opt/samba4/lib64/python2.7/site-packages/samba/upgrade.py", line
926, in upgrade_from_samba3
    raise ProvisioningError("User 'Administrator' in your existing
directory does not have SID ending in -500")

What are my options here?

Cheers,
Kamen


More information about the samba-technical mailing list